The building served as the original public library for Naperville from its construction in 1897 until 1986, when the library operations moved to the new, modern Nichols Library on Jefferson Avenue in Naperville. [2] [3] The building is constructed with yellow brick and indigenous limestone, of a much lighter design than is typical for the style.

The Martin Mitchell Mansion, known to the original owners as Pine Craig, is a historic residence. The 12-room house was built with materials from Naperville businesses and stone from DuPage River quarries. George Martin II was the son of an immigrant from Scotland and made his fortune by taking advantage of local resources.
